Q: Is 801,673,881 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 801,673,881 is not a prime number.

Why is 801,673,881 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 801673881 can be evenly divided by 1 3 227 681 1,177,201 3,531,603 267,224,627 and 801,673,881, with no remainder.

Since 801,673,881 cannot be divided by just 1 and 801,673,881, it is not a prime number.
